While the flight duration may vary for Business Class travelers depending on the departure and arrival airports, here are some average flight times from popular locations you might be interested in:
Newark Airport to Orlando Airport: 2 hours 50 minutes
Boston to Orlando Airport: 3 hours 19 minutes
Philadelphia to Orlando Airport: 2 hours 42 minutes
Detroit Metropolitan Wayne County Airport to Orlando Airport: 2 hours 53 minutes
Chicago O'Hare Intl Airport to Orlando Airport: 3 hours 4 minutes
Baltimore to Orlando Airport: 2 hours 27 minutes
Minneapolis to Orlando Airport: 3 hours 39 minutes
Cleveland to Orlando Airport: 2 hours 39 minutes
Raleigh to Orlando Airport: 1 hour 56 minutes
Hartford to Orlando Airport: 3 hours 4 minutes

Although the minimum age for a child to fly alone is five, airlines that offer an unaccompanied minor (UMNR) service may have their own age limits, which could be impacted by factors such as flight length, timing, and layovers. It is recommended that you verify with the airline you are booking with for travel from United States to Orlando Airport.
